Asundexian (BAY 2433334) is an orally active coagulation factor Xia (FXIa) inhibitor. Asundexian binds directly, potently, and reversibly to the active site of FXIa and thereby inhibits its activity. Asundexian inhibits human FXIa in buffer with an IC50 of 1 nM .

Milvexian is an orally bioavailable, small-molecule, reversible, direct antagonists of factor Xia, with the Ki of 0.11, 0.38, 0.64, 490, 350 nM for human, rabbit, dog, rat, mouse, respectively. Milvexian shows anti-thrombosis activity in vitro and in vivo, and can be used for thrombus study .

FD-IN-1 (Compound 12) is an orally bioavailable and selective factor D (FD) inhibitor with an IC50 of 12 nM. Complement FD, a highly specific S1 serine protease, plays a central role in the alternative complement pathway of the innate immune system. FD-IN-1 also inhibits factor XIa (FXIa) and Tryptase β2 with IC50s of 7.7 and 6.5 µM, respectively .

BMS-262084 is a potent, selective and irreversible inhibitor of factor XIa, with an IC50 of 2.8 nM against human factor XIa. BMS-262084 also inhibits human tryptase (IC50=5 nM). BMS-262084 exhibits antithrombotic effects .

Frunexian (EP-7041) is a selective and potent inhibitor of coagulation factor XI/activated factor XI, targeting to factor XIa. Frunexian exhibits antithrombotic activity, with no bleeding liability in rat mesenteric arterial puncture model. Frunexian can be used in extracorporeal membrane oxygenation (ECMO) research .

BMS-962212 is a factor XIa (FXIa) inhibitor with a Ki of 0.7 nM against human FXIa and a Ki of 3 nM against rabbit FXIa. BMS-962212 blocks thrombosis while preserving normal hemostatic function. BMS-962212 is applicable to thrombosis-related research .

Vicatertide (SB-01, Peniel 2000) is a polypeptide with both competitive inhibitory activity against TGF-β1 and selective inhibitory activity against human factor XIa (hFXIa, with a Ka of 80 nM for hFXIa). Vicatertide binds allosterically to the two binding sites of dimeric hFXI/hFXIa, while directly binding to activated TGF-β1, selectively blocking the Smad1/5/8 pathway and maintaining low-level activation of the Smad2 pathway to enhance the synthesis of type Ⅱ collagen and aggrecan. Vicatertide inhibits thrombus formation in arteriovenous thrombosis models, and also reduces thrombus weight and thrombus incidence in mouse lung cancer models. Vicatertide can be used for research on degenerative disc disease and thrombosis-related diseases .

Catechin 7-O-beta-D-glucopyranoside is an orally active natural product found in Ulmus davidiana and Paeonia obovata. Catechin 7-O-β-D-glucopyranoside shows antioxidant and anti-inflammatory activities, and attenuates mitochondrial dysfunction. Catechin 7-O-beta-D-glucopyranoside can be used in intestinal inflammatory disease research .

Boc-Gln-Gly-Arg-AMC is a fluorogenic substrate for kallikrein (PKa), coagulation factor XIIa (FXIIa) and coagulation factor XIa (FXIa). Boc-Gln-Gly-Arg-AMC enables fluorescence-based activity assays for PKa, FXIIa and FXIa .

Boc-Glu(OBzl)-Ala-Arg-AMC is a fluorogenic substrate for coagulation factor XIa and trypsin. The cleavage of the amide bond between arginine and the methylcoumarin amide group releases fluorescent 7-Amino-4-methylcoumarin (HY-D0027) .

FXIa/Plasma kallikrein-IN-1 is an inhibitor of coagulation factor XIa (FXIa) and plasma kallikrein with Ki values of 187.70 nM and 151.6 nM, respectively. FXIa/Plasma kallikrein-IN-1 can be used in the research of thromboembolic diseases .

FXIa-IN-16 (Compound 43) is an orally active and selective Factor XIa (FXIa) inhibitor with an IC50 of 0.19 nM. FXIa-IN-16 exhibits strong anticoagulant and antithrombotic activities and shows good safety in mice. FXIa-IN-16 can be used in the research related to the treatment of thrombosis .

Milvexian TFA (BMS-986177 TFA) is a factor XIa inhibitor with biological activity to prevent venous thromboembolism. Milvexian TFA was effective in reducing the occurrence of venous thromboembolism in patients undergoing knee replacement surgery. Milvexian TFA has good selectivity and shows significant inhibitory effects on plasma kallikrein and trypsin. Milvexian TFA has a bioavailability of 32%, which means it has a high absorption rate in the body. Milvexian TFA showed a relatively low risk of bleeding in clinical trials .

FXIa-IN-15 (Compound (S)-10h) is an inhibitor for Factor XIa (FXIa) and plasma kallikrein (PKa) with an IC50 of 0.38 nM and 59.2 nM. FXIa-IN-15 exhibits anticoagulant efficacy, that extends 50% activated partial thromboplastin time (aPTT) with EC1.5X of 0.55 μM .

Bovine Factor XIa is an enzyme, which is involved in the intrinsic pathway of blood coagulation. Bovine Factor XIa is highly selective and exhibits a minimal extended substrate recognition site of at least five residues long. Bovine Factor XIa is reactive as Bovine Factor IXa (HY-E70393I) does, that it cleaves all the peptides bearing factor IX activation site sequences .
